Intra-assay Precision (Precision within an assay): CV%<8% | ||||||
Three samples of known concentration were tested twenty times on one plate to assess. | ||||||
Inter-assay Precision (Precision between assays): CV%<10% | ||||||
Three samples of known concentration were tested in twenty assays to assess. | ||||||

Thrombin-antithrombin complex (TAT) serves as a biomarker for coagulation activation and thrombotic processes. This complex forms when thrombin, the key enzyme in blood coagulation, binds irreversibly to its primary physiological inhibitor, antithrombin. TAT levels reflect the balance between coagulation activation and inhibition, making it a valuable indicator for monitoring hemostatic disorders, thrombosis risk evaluation, and anticoagulant therapy effectiveness in research applications.
The Rat thrombin-antithrombin complex TAT ELISA Kit (CSB-E08432r) is designed for quantitative measurement of TAT in Rattus norvegicus samples. This sandwich ELISA accommodates serum, plasma, cell culture supernates, tissue homogenates, and cell lysates with a detection range of 31.25 pg/mL to 2000 pg/mL and sensitivity of 7.8 pg/mL. The assay requires 50-100 μL sample volume, operates with detection at 450 nm wavelength, and can be completed within 1-5 hours.

This ELISA kit has been used in research examining coagulation and thrombosis-related processes across different experimental models. Studies have applied the kit to measure thrombin-antithrombin complex levels in various sample types including cell culture supernatants, tissue homogenates, and plasma samples. The applications span from cellular studies examining coagulation marker expression to animal model studies of hypercoagulability and thrombotic states.
• Coagulation research: Evaluation of thrombin-antithrombin complex levels alongside other hemostatic markers in studies examining blood coagulation processes and anticoagulant mechanisms
• Cerebrovascular studies: Measurement of coagulation markers in brain tissue homogenates from animal models studying ischemia-reperfusion injury and associated thrombotic responses
• Hypercoagulability evaluation: Analysis of plasma samples to evaluate markers of enhanced coagulation activity and thrombotic risk in experimental settings
• Cell culture applications: Quantification of coagulation-related proteins in cell supernatants to study cellular responses and protein expression under various experimental conditions
